Finding the Right Lehenga for a Haldi Ceremony


Haldi festivities often favour lively colours and comfortable garments that make movement easy. Yellow, mustard, ivory, peach, lime, and soft orange are frequently chosen for a Haldi Wedding Festive outfit outfit. Lightweight georgette, cotton blends, organza, and other breathable materials may be particularly appropriate for daytime ceremonies.

Flower-inspired embroidery, delicate mirror detailing, and colourful borders can create a festive appearance without making the garment unnecessarily heavy. A lightweight Dupatta design also helps improve freedom of movement during a vibrant ceremony. Creating a Vibrant Mehendi Party Wear Look


Mehendi celebrations invite creative colour pairings and individual styling. Emerald green, turquoise, coral, pink, fuchsia, and contrasting shades are especially popular for Mehendi party wear styles. Floral patterns and mirror embellishments can complement the cheerful atmosphere while creating attractive photographs.

Comfort should receive just as much consideration because Mehendi functions often continue for many hours. A lightweight skirt, well-supported blouse, and easy-to-manage dupatta can make it considerably easier to sit, walk, and dance. Creating an Impression at the Sangeet and Cocktail Party


Evening functions provide an opportunity to experiment with glamour. Sequins, beads, metallic thread, rich embroidery, and structured blouse designs are particularly suitable for Sangeet and cocktail celebration celebrations. Rich jewel tones including royal blue, emerald, wine, plum, and deep purple can create a dramatic evening appearance.

Modern styling may feature asymmetric blouses, coordinated jackets, statement sleeves, or stylishly arranged dupattas. The goal is to balance visual impact with comfortable movement. Since dancing frequently plays a central role in a Sangeet celebration, an unnecessarily heavy skirt may restrict comfort. Choosing the correct weight and secure tailoring can create an elegant outfit that remains comfortable and practical all evening.

Choosing the Right Lehenga for Your Body Shape


Fit can influence the overall appearance more than the amount of embellishment. Petite women may prefer high-waisted skirts and vertical detailing, which can produce a more elongated visual line. A-line skirts can complement pear-shaped figures by flowing naturally from the waist while decorated blouses attract attention upwards.

Gently fitted or panelled silhouettes may enhance hourglass proportions, while flowing skirts and structured necklines may help balance fuller midsections. Taller women can confidently try layered skirts, wider borders, statement prints, and bold dupattas. Popular Fabrics and Designer Details


The choice of fabric affects movement, comfort, visual appeal, and suitability across seasons. Silk delivers a rich, structured appearance, while georgette offers softer movement. Organza creates a crisp and contemporary look and often works beautifully for daytime events. Chiffon is lightweight and graceful, whereas velvet delivers an opulent effect ideal for cooler conditions and evening celebrations.

Current Indian Fashion celebrates mirror work, floral embroidery, monotone styling, cape-inspired designs, jacket lehengas, pastel palettes, and hand-finished zari detailing. Rather than following a trend simply due to its popularity, shoppers should consider whether the design can be worn again for future celebrations.

Why Good Tailoring and Alterations Are Important


Even the finest garment may lose visual impact if the fit is unsuitable. Blouse proportions, sleeve shape, neckline, skirt waist, and overall length should flatter the wearer's proportions. Careful alterations can turn a standard garment into an ensemble that looks significantly more refined.

This is particularly important for Indian Dress styles styles with structured blouses or heavily decorated skirts. Customised alterations can improve comfort and ensure decorative elements are positioned properly.
